Le t-shirt Propre is a French clothing brand founded in 2016 in Aveyron by Fabien and his uncle Mathieu, later joined by Fabien's sister Odile. Their starting question was simple: why does a basic t-shirt so often hide its origins? The answer became a small, family-run label producing wardrobe essentials entirely in France.
The collection centres on t-shirts in GOTS-certified organic cotton, in 100% French linen sourced from Normandy, and in Mérinos d'Arles wool. The same French wool is used for sweaters, turtlenecks, plaids and reinforced socks knitted in the Tarn, where the brand's sewing and knitting partners are based. Garments are designed for everyday wear, with men's and women's cuts and a focus on simple, long-lasting silhouettes.
What distinguishes Le t-shirt Propre in the made-in-France basics category is the combination of fully traceable French materials, regional production and a family-scale operation where the founders oversee each step.
